大伊人青草狠狠久久-大伊香蕉精品视频在线-大伊香蕉精品一区视频在线-大伊香蕉在线精品不卡视频-大伊香蕉在线精品视频75-大伊香蕉在线精品视频人碰人

您現在的位置:程序化交易>> 期貨公式>> 金字塔等>> 其他期貨軟件知識>>正文內容

這個 C++ 函數為什么不會輸出圖線?/////中間的代碼去掉。是可以顯示正確的圖線的。為什么,怎么改。讓pData->m_pResultBuf3[i2]=priceup;輸出 [金字塔]

  • 咨詢內容:


    __declspec(dllexport) int WINAPI AMA(CALCINFO* pData)
    {
     if(pData->m_pfParam1 && pData->m_pfParam2 &&  //參數1,2有效
      pData->m_nParam1Start>=0 &&     //參數1為序列數
      pData->m_pfParam3==NULL)     //有2個參數
     {
      const float*  pValue = pData->m_pfParam1; //參數1
      int nFirst = pData->m_nParam1Start;   //有效值起始位
      float fParam = *pData->m_pfParam2;   //參數2
      int nPeriod = (int)fParam;   
      if( nFirst >= 0 && nPeriod > 0 )
      {
       float fTotal; 
       float noise,diff,signal,erc;
       int i, k;
       int datacount;
        datacount= pData->m_nNumData;
       if (datacount<nPeriod)
        for (i=0;i<nPeriod-1;i++)
        fTotal=pData->m_pData[i].m_fClose;    
       else
        i=nPeriod-1;
        fTotal=pData->m_pData[i-1].m_fClose;
        while (i<=datacount)
        {
         noise=0.0f;
         diff=0.0f;
         for (k=1;k<nPeriod;k++)
         {
          diff=fabs(pValue[i-k+1]-pValue[i-k]);
          noise+=diff;
         }
         signal=fabs(pValue[i]-pValue[i-nPeriod+1]);
         if (noise==0.0f)
          erc=0.0f;
         else
         {
          erc=(signal/noise);     
         }
         fTotal+=erc*(pValue[i]-fTotal);
         pData->m_pResultBuf[i] = fTotal;

    //--------------------------------------------
    ////////下面插入pricedn值 and priceup值 的計算:
         int i2;
         float pricedn;
         float priceup;
         int k1,k2;
         double mindiff;
         float noise1,diff1,signal1,erc1;
         i2=i;
         mindiff=0.01;
         if (pData->m_pResultBuf[i2]>=pData->m_pResultBuf[i2-1])
          for (k1=1;k1<=1000000;k1++)
          {
           pricedn=pData->m_pData[i2-1].m_fClose-k1*mindiff;
           noise1=0;
              diff1=0;
              signal1=0;
              for (k2=1;k2<=nPeriod-1;k2++)          
           {
            diff1=fabs(pValue[i2-k2+1]-pValue[i2-k2]);
            noise1=noise1+diff1;
           }
            
              noise1=noise1+fabs(pricedn-pValue[i2-1]);       
              signal1=fabs(pricedn-pValue[i-nPeriod+1]); 
              if (noise1==0)
               erc1=0;
              else
               erc1=signal1/noise1;           
              pData->m_pResultBuf1[i2]=pData->m_pResultBuf[i2-1]+erc1*(pricedn-pData->m_pResultBuf[i2-1]);
              if (pData->m_pResultBuf1[i2] < pData->m_pResultBuf[i2-1])
               k1=1000001;
           pData->m_pResultBuf2[i2]=pricedn;
          }

         else

          for (k1=1;k1<=1000000;k1++)
          {
           priceup=pData->m_pData[i2-1].m_fClose+k1*mindiff;
           noise1=0;
              diff1=0;
              signal1=0;
              for (k2=1;k2<=nPeriod-2;k2++)          
           {
            diff1=fabs(pValue[i2-k2+1]-pValue[i2-k2]);       
               noise1=noise1+diff1;
           }
            
              noise1=noise1+fabs(priceup-pData->m_pData[i2-1].m_fClose);       
              signal1=fabs(priceup-pData->m_pData[i2-(nPeriod-1)].m_fClose); 
              if (noise1==0)
               erc1=0;
              else
               erc1=signal1/noise1;           
              pData->m_pResultBuf1[i2]=pData->m_pResultBuf[i2-1]+erc1*(priceup-pData->m_pResultBuf[i2-1]);
              if (pData->m_pResultBuf1[i2]>=pData->m_pResultBuf[i2-1])
               k1=1000001;
           pData->m_pResultBuf3[i2]=priceup;
          }

    //pricedn值 and priceup值 計算結束
    //----------------------------------------------
         i++;
        }
       return nFirst+nPeriod-1;
      }
     }
     return -1;
    }

     

  • 金字塔客服:   return nFirst+nPeriod-1;和return -1;
    有什么作用

     

  • 用戶回復:

    pResultBuf1,pResultBuf2等這些都不是金字塔支持的類型。

    返回值的定義問題,請參考 http://www.weistock.com/bbs/dispbbs.asp?boardid=4&Id=10616


【字體: 】【打印文章】【查看評論

相關文章

    沒有相關內容
主站蜘蛛池模板: 久久这里只有精品1 | 骚婷婷| 精品国产免费观看久久久 | 黄视频在线观看www 黄视频在线观看网站 | 亚洲一区二区三区欧美 | 国产精品亚洲精品一区二区三区 | 四虎国产精品视频免费看 | 激情综合色综合啪啪开心 | 四虎影视在线观看永久地址 | 久久午夜国产片 | 美女视频黄的免费视频网页 | 亚洲四虎| 久久精品国产清自在天天线 | 免费国产小视频在线观看 | 牛牛影视在线观看片免费 | 午夜国产福利 | 麻豆国产原创 | 特级一级毛片 | 91精品久久久久久久久久 | 精品久久中文久久久 | 久久天天躁夜夜躁2019 | 国产美女做爰免费视 | 一级毛片免费看 | 国产福利第一视频 | 久久午夜影院 | 免费在线观看h片 | 伊人五月天综合 | 在线免费国产 | 日韩精品欧美亚洲高清有无 | 日本一区二区三区免费在线观看 | 欧美成人丝袜视频在线观看 | 国产精品社区 | 午夜激情男女 | 毛片a级| 在线免费一区二区 | 欧美日韩亚洲成人 | 成人永久福利在线观看不卡 | 欧美一区二区影院 | 四虎最新免费观看网址 | 久久香蕉国产线看观看精品yw | 国产日韩精品一区在线不卡 |